Life Sciences Aggregate-Spending Market - Report Scope:

The Life Sciences Aggregate-Spending Market encompasses a wide range of activities, processes, and technologies used by pharmaceutical companies, biotechnology firms, and medical device manufacturers to track and report their financial interactions with healthcare professionals, institutions, and stakeholders. This market serves life sciences companies, regulatory agencies, healthcare providers, and patients, offering aggregate-spending solutions and services for compliance with transparency regulations, industry guidelines, and reporting requirements. Aggregate-spending initiatives aim to promote transparency, integrity, and ethical conduct in industry relationships, safeguarding patient interests, and ensuring public trust. Market growth is driven by increasing regulatory scrutiny, evolving transparency requirements, and industry initiatives to enhance accountability and disclosure practices.

Market Growth Drivers:

The global Life Sciences Aggregate-Spending Market benefits from several key growth drivers. Regulatory mandates, such as the Physician Payments Sunshine Act in the United States and the EFPIA Disclosure Code in Europe, require life sciences companies to disclose financial relationships with healthcare professionals and organizations, driving demand for aggregate-spending solutions and compliance services. Moreover, growing public concern about conflicts of interest, undue influence, and transparency in healthcare decision-making underscores the importance of transparent reporting and disclosure practices. Additionally, advancements in data analytics, automation, and interoperability enable life sciences companies to streamline aggregate-spending processes, improve data accuracy, and enhance compliance efficiency. Furthermore, industry initiatives, voluntary codes of conduct, and stakeholder collaboration foster best practices and standardization in aggregate-spending reporting and transparency efforts.

Market Restraints:

Despite its significant growth prospects, the Life Sciences Aggregate-Spending Market faces challenges related to data quality, regulatory complexity, and stakeholder engagement. Ensuring data accuracy, completeness, and timeliness in aggregate-spending reporting requires robust systems, processes, and governance frameworks, which may pose implementation challenges for life sciences companies. Moreover, evolving regulatory requirements and jurisdictional differences in transparency laws and reporting standards create compliance complexities and administrative burdens for multinational organizations operating in diverse markets. Additionally, stakeholder perceptions, trust issues, and misconceptions about industry relationships and financial disclosures may impact transparency initiatives and stakeholder engagement efforts. Addressing these barriers requires collaboration between life sciences companies, regulatory authorities, healthcare stakeholders, and patient advocacy groups to develop pragmatic solutions, foster transparency, and build trust in industry relationships.
